We are recruiting on behalf of our global consulting client for a Product Owner to sit within the Global Technology (Infrastructure & Cloud) business area. You would be responsible for engaging with customers, shaping the vision for the product/service, working with an engineering team to develop to create and publish an achievable roadmap, with appropriate prioritising of delivery on a day-to-day basis.

Principal accountabilities:

  • Define, communicate, and maintain vision for assigned products/services that meets or exceeds customer expectations.
  • Develop an achievable roadmap in collaboration with the relevant engineering team that can be used as a tracking and progress vehicle for stakeholder communications.
  • Work within the pre-agreed Service Level Objectives for the assigned product, ensuring that the LIVE products are supported by the Modern Operations teams in a robust and stable way.
  • Manage the product backlog, prioritising delivery on a day-to-day basis and address questions and concerns from the engineering team, ensuring guidance and work activities are aligned to the needs of the customer and their outcomes.
  • Report on the performance of the assigned product, with both operational and product value delivery insights.
  • Work with the team and senior leaders to assess if opportunities for improvements are available.
  • Collaborate with the assigned team to enable a full experience to customers when using the assigned product, ensuring they interact with minimal teams.
  • Engage with stakeholders to share appropriate delivery progress information and collaborate with the identification of alternative solutions where appropriate.
  • Ensure any system or process changes that impact customer journeys have been reviewed by business stakeholders to determine the impact of the changes on the delivery of customer outcomes.

Required Experience:

  • Product ownership experience, including story-mapping, budget management, working stakeholders, developing and maintaining product roadmaps, writing user stories
  • Understanding of product management principles, methodologies, and best practices
  • In-depth knowledge of agile frameworks (e.g. Scrum, Kanban) and the roles, ceremonies, and artifacts within scrum
  • Proficiency in project management tools and software (e.g. Jira, Confluence)
  • Understanding of aligning product strategy with client goals
  • Understanding of software development processes and technologies
